I still like the game and bet on a regular basis. Over the years I have bet on a variation of blackjack called "The Take it Leave it Method". You won’t get loaded with this method or beat the casino, nonetheless you will experience an abundance of fun. This tactic is based on the fact that chemin de fer seems to be a game of runs. When you are hot your on fire, and when you’re not you are NOT!

I play basic strategy vingt-et-un. When I don’t win I wager the lowest amount allowed on the subsequent hand. If I lose again I bet the table minimum on the subsequent hand again etc. Once I win I take the winnings paid to me and I bet the original bet again. If I win this hand I then leave the winnings paid to me and now have double my original wager on the table. If I win again I take the payout paid to me, and if I succeed the next hand I leave it for a total of 4 times my original bet. I keep wagering this way "Take it Leave it etc". Once I don’t win I return the bet back down to the original amount.

I am very strict and do not "chicken out". It gets very fun on occasion. If you win a few hands in a row your bets go up very quickly. Before you realize it you are betting $100-200per hand. I have had awesome runs a couple of times now. I departed a $5 table at the Wynn a couple of years back with $750 after 20 mins using this technique! And a couple of months ago in Macau I left a table with $1200!

You need to comprehend that you can squander much faster this way too!. But it really makes the game more exciting. And you will be amazed at the streaks you notice gamble this way. Here is a chart of what you would bet if you kept winning at a $5 game.

Bet 5 dollar
Take 5 dollar paid-out to you, leave the first $5 bet

Wager 5 dollar
Leave $5 paid to you for a total wager of 10 dollar

Wager ten dollar
Take ten dollar paid-out to you, leave the first 10 dollar wager

Wager $10
Leave ten dollar paid to you for a total wager of twenty dollar

Wager $20
Take twenty dollar paid to you, leave the original 20 dollar bet

Wager twenty dollar
Leave $20 paid to you for a total wager of 40 dollar

Bet $40
Take forty dollar paid to you, leave the initial $40 bet

Bet 40 dollar
Leave $40 paid to you for a total wager of eighty dollar

Bet 80 dollar
Take eighty dollar paid to you, leave the first eighty dollar bet

Wager eighty dollar
Leave $80 paid to you for a total wager of $160

Bet $160
Take $160 paid-out to you, leave the original $160 bet

If you left at this moment you would be up three hundred and fifteen dollars !!

It’s hard to go on a run this long, but it often happen. And when it does you can’t alter and drop your wager or the end result won’t be the same.
